The classes I am interested in are:
  • Pilates - a group of exercises designed to strengthen and lengthen the muscle groups. Similar to yoga except that you flow from one movement to another using your core.
  • Basic Step - basic moves, basic patterns a great way for you to have fun & learn. Whether you are a beginner or not you will burn those calories!
  • Yoga - a relaxing mind & body experience that includes whole body stretching and total relaxation.
  • Tai Chi - health, meditation, martial arts, the three aspects of the study of Tai Chi. This involves slow, gentle, repetitive work that teaches how leverage is generated.
  • Express Fitness - a 30 minute workout that's perfect for anyone. The class format will take you from the floor to the Step or the Bosu.
  • "Lite" Workout - this class is a "lighter" version of our weighted workout class. A class to increase muscular strength and endurance as well as flexibility through the use of weights, tubing, balance balls, medicine balls, body bars, etc. Total body conditioning! This is designed for the beginner or the experienced exerciser.
